Brief Description
Conveyance of 71000 acres in Table Cape, Mahia Peninsula on 13 February 1839.

Signatories include:
Solicitor - D Coole of Sydney.
Purchasers - Daniel Cooper, James Holt and William Bernard Rhodes
Sellers - These names are faded and spelled differently throughout the document:
Wanga (alias Brown), Mauauouwai, Tukareao, Waiumu, Poiro, Erito Maro Kohuwai (Marauowai), Poiro, Poroiwi.
Interpreter - William Burton
Further signatories - John Lennon and James Bain. A further three signatures are faded.

Includes facial tattoos of Māori signatories and two wax seals. Total cost of 71000 acres was £50.00 payable to 5 signatories.

Attached is a receipt from the Registers Office in Sydney dated 20th May 1840 and numbered 933.
